    What to do if my Thinkware D1K32D Dash Cameras memory card cannot be recognized?

      If your Thinkware dash camera doesn't recognize the memory card, ensure it's inserted correctly. Also, power off the device, remove the card, and check the card slot for any damage to the contacts. Finally, make sure you're using an authentic THINKWARE memory card.

    Why is my Thinkware D1K32D video unclear?

      If your Thinkware dash camera video appears unclear, it might be due to the protective film still being on the camera lens. Make sure to remove this film. Also, check the installation location of the front or rear camera, turn on the product, and then adjust the camera's viewing angle.

    Why GPS signal cannot be received on Thinkware D1K32D Dash Cameras?

      The GPS signal may be weak because you are in an out-of-service area or surrounded by tall buildings. Try again on a clear day in an open location. Also, GPS signal reception may not be available during storms or heavy rain. Try again on a clear day at a location that is known to have good GPS reception.
